
Partridge are small native European game birds that are found across the European mainland and the UK. There are two main sub-species that are pursued by hunters. The red-legged partridge is native to France, Spain and Italy. They have also been introduced to the UK and are now considered naturalized. The other species is the grey partridge which naturally occurs in the UK and across the European mainland into Asia. Shooting for red-legged partridge is done across the UK and Spain. They are a sporty bird that favors flying in coveys, which makes for some excellent sport. They are best shot off rolling downland where they star burst over hedgerows, or driven off high hills where they present a very challenging shot.
